Updated 15m ago Here are the 8 Democrats who voted to move forward on the funding bill The final vote on advancing the House-passed continuing resolution was 60 to 40. Eight Democrats joined all but one Republican to move forward on the bill: Catherine Cortez Masto of Nevada Dick Durbin of Illinois John Fetterman
28m ago More than 1,500 flights canceled as of early Monday More than 1,500 flights within, into or out of the U.S. were canceled as of early Monday, according to FlightAware, which tracks airline disruptions. Another 1,400 flights on Monday were delayed. The disruptions follow more than 2,900 flight cancellations and over 10,000
